Leonardo Bonucci is an Italian professional footballer who is widely regarded as one of the best defenders in the world. Born on May 1, 1987, in Viterbo, Italy, Bonucci has had an illustrious career, playing for top clubs and representing the Italian national team.

Early Career and Rise to Prominence

Bonucci began his professional career at the young age of 17, playing for the Italian club Viterbese. He quickly caught the attention of bigger clubs and was signed by Inter Milan in 2005. However, it was during his time at Bari and subsequently at Juventus that he truly established himself as a top-class defender.

At Juventus, Bonucci formed a formidable defensive partnership with Giorgio Chiellini and Andrea Barzagli, earning the trio the nickname “BBC.” Together, they played a crucial role in Juventus’ dominance in Serie A, winning numerous league titles.

Goal Records and Reputations

While Bonucci is primarily known for his defensive prowess, he has also contributed significantly in front of the goal. Throughout his career, he has scored several crucial goals, both for his club and the national team. His ability to read the game and make intelligent runs into the box has made him a threat during set-pieces.

As a defender, Bonucci’s reputation is unmatched. He possesses exceptional ball-playing skills, composure under pressure, and excellent positional awareness. His leadership qualities and ability to organize the defense have earned him immense respect from teammates and opponents alike.

Awards and Nominations

Throughout his career, Leonardo Bonucci has received numerous awards and nominations for his exceptional performances. Some of the notable accolades include:

  • UEFA European Championship Team of the Tournament: 2016
  • Serie A Defender of the Year: 2015, 2016, 2017, 2018
  • UEFA Champions League Squad of the Season: 2016, 2017
  • FIFA FIFPro World XI: 2017
